Responsibilities

Peraton is seeking an IT Analyst for the Department of Defense (DoD) DMDC Enterprise Law Enforcement Support Services (ELEs2)program. This IT Analyst/Case Management Specialist conducts complex data queries, reviewing and analyzing identity-related records across multiple classified and unclassified systems, and collaborating with DMDC application teams to resolve sensitive investigative requests. Generates timely, well-documented, and accurate responses to high-priority inquiries from defense and federal investigative agencies. Responsibilities also extend to supporting classified programs, necessitating access to highly secure environments, and maintaining situational awareness of critical IT and data governance matters across secure systems. Responsibilities include:

    Providing analytical support for identity management and credentialing data in response to federal and DoD law enforcement and intelligence community requests.
  • Interpreting mainframe and database queries to support investigative case resolution by integrating biometric and identity data with investigative tools
  • Documenting all intelligence and law enforcement data requests thoroughly and consistently.
  • Categorizing requests based on data-driven classifications to aid analysis and reporting.
  • Providing weekly status updates on open requests to government stakeholders.
  • Submitting monthly metrics and Senior Management Review (SMR) reports detailing volume, type, and duration of requests processed, including handling of classified or emergency inquiries.
  • Coordinating, documenting, and updating functional requirements in collaboration with internal stakeholders and external law enforcement/intelligence users.
  • Participating in project reviews and maintain accountability for schedule baselines and resource impacts due to evolving requirements.
  • Maintaining access to highly secure environments as needed to support sensitive or classified operations.
  • Correlate biometric results with biographic and investigative data
  • Conduct social media and open-source intelligence (OSINT) investigations
  • Use formal case management systems (IMESA or others)
  • Build and maintain investigative case files
  • Support complex investigations tied to DoD/LE requirements
  • Support knowledge transfer and system audits


Qualifications

  • Minimum of 8 years with BS/BA; Minimum of 6 years with MS/MA; Minimum of 3 years with PhD
  • Must be a U.S Citizen
  • Able to obtain a TS clearance
  • IAT III Certification ( must have one of the following CISSP, CASP+CE, CCNP Security, CISA, CISSP (or Associate), GCED, GCIH, CCSP
  • 3-5 years supporting law enforcement or intelligence analysis
  • Experience with OSINT tools, LEA platforms
  • Proficiency with DoD personnel data tools
